Abdullah The Butcher Speaks Out - HOF Induction, More

Abdullah the Butcher recently spoke to Main Event Radio (CJLO 1690AM in Montreal) about his WWE Hall of Fame induction and more. Check out the highlights:

On his induction: "They called me about a month ago. When they called me I was sleeping and they told me they want to put me in the Hall of Fame; I jumped up and said just a minute. I ran to the bathroom really fast, started putting water on my face, started smacking my face. I ran back and he says 'This is Johnny Ace, we want to put you in the Hall of Fame.' I thought I was dreaming. I'm the one who started hardcore. I started hardcore on Johnny Rougeau, the Rougeau brothers, Maurice [Mad Dog] Vachon, and my manager Eddie "The Brain" Creatchman. I was in the business for many years. I scared a lot of people but they all liked me. I was not expecting it when they told me they were going to induct me into the Hall of Fame. They left me for last because I am #1. They left me for the last because I was the only one left."

On why he never wrestled for WWE: "The guys in the wrestling business, when you're a top man and you're drawing a lot of money, they don't want the promoter to bring you in so they started to make up a lot of stories about Abdullah the Butcher. They told Vince don't bring him in because he's going to stab people with a fork, he's going to do this, he's going to do that."

On the people who have emulated him: "It's not the point that somebody tries to take your style. If you look at Mercedes Benz style, now you've got other cars who started looking the same way. They're trying to sell cars. The guys who are trying to do what I used to do, they're trying to draw people. It's the same reason I did it. I'll never retire though...I'll keep going. I started in 1961, 50 years. I loved working with all my opponents, it was always a pleasure to wrestle. I would also like to thank the fans, a lot of people helped me get into the Hall of Fame, they wrote into WWE asking for me. Thank you very much and may God bless you all."
